The station is unmanned, so there is no ticket office available, but fret not. Ticket machines around the station ensure you can collect your tickets purchased online or buy them directly with ease. If you are eligible for discounts, accessible ticket machines can apply Disabled Persons Railcard reductions ensuring inclusivity. Travellers should note that while the ticket machines are accessible by design, the station itself lacks step-free access, which may pose a challenge for those with reduced mobility.
Need some extra assistance? While there aren't staff help points, you can arrange for assisted travel. It’s advisable to book this service ahead of time to ensure all arrangements are in place at your destination station. Note that West Sutton station does not include amenities such as toilets, refreshments, shops, or Wi-Fi - so plan ahead to meet those needs before your arrival.
Thinking about extending your journey beyond the train ride? Perfect! West Sutton offers several connections that make it easy to continue your travel. While the nearest bus services are accessible, specific details will demand guidance from the Onward Travel Information Map on-site. The station does not feature taxi ranks or cycle hire facilities, but bicycle stands are available for those preferring to pedal to their next stop.

Rhyl Train Station is well-equipped with facilities to ensure a pleasant travel experience.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with the station's well-staffed ticket office operating from early morning until late in the evening. You’ll find convenient ticket machines which accept both cash and cards, offering accessible options for all travelers. It's reassuring to note that you can collect tickets bought online directly from these machines.
Concerned about accessibility? Rhyl Station is designed with step-free access, featuring facilities that cater to everyone’s needs. Take advantage of acc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and staff assistance available throughout the week. Public conveniences such as acc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are located on Platform 1. Additionally, the station provides free Wi-Fi, making it easy to stay connected.
Satisfaction doesn’t stop at the station with a host of onward travel options available. Bus connections are conveniently accessed just outside the station with the option of purchasing a PlusBus ticket for unlimited travel within the area, offering exceptional value. Despite the absence of a dedicated cycle hire facility, ample bicycle storage is available, should you prefer to explore the town on two wheels. For those who might need rail replacement services, they can find them at Bay 6, ensuring continued travel even through disruptions.
